Fukuoka City Announces Fukuoka Prize 2026 Laureates; Grand Prize Awarded to HO Tzu Nyen, Singaporean Artist

 

Fukuoka City (Secretariat of Fukuoka Prize Committee) on Friday, May 22, announced the laureates for the Fukuoka Prize 2026 to honor those who have made outstanding achievements in the fields of Asian studies and arts and culture.

 

The Grand Prize has been awarded to HO Tzu Nyen, a contemporary artist who depicts Asian history and memory through visual expression. The Academic Prize has been awarded to Caroline Sy HAU, a Filipino scholar who discerns the freedom to choose the future of people in the Southeast Asian societies. Pichet KLUNCHUN, an innovative Thai dancer who connects the traditions of Asian dance to the modern world, has won the Arts and Culture Prize.

The Award Ceremony will be held on Monday, September 14, 2026. HO Tzu Nyen's and Pichet KLUNCHUN's public lectures are scheduled for Saturday, September 12, and Caroline HAU's for Tuesday, September 15. Bookings for all events will open from the middle of July.

*Advance bookings are mandatory & admission free. Archived recordings of each event will be available online later.
